List of topics from the opening workshop :

  • Group Integrals
  • Eigenvalue Distributions , Smallest / Largest Eigenvalues
  • Hypergeometric Functions
  • Distributions Arising From Incomplete Data
  • Applications of pde-s (as in Muirhead-s book)
  • Probability Inequalities (especially for p.d. random matrices)
